The Use OF Synthetic Polymer As A Drying Aid In Pelletizing
In February 1974 a continuous synthetic polymer dosing plant was installed at Hamersley Iron Pty._x000D_
Limited's Pellet Plant at Dampier. The polymer, supplied in a liquid sus- pension, is used to improve the drying characteristics of green pellets. 'Three years of test work were involved in the development of the use of polymers. Polymer is continuously dosed to the balling spray water system at a rate determined by the flow of spray water to the discs. Problems have been experienced with handling the polymer in 44 gallon drums, the increased viscosity of the spray water, disc overloads, increased bed strength and increased "stickiness" of pellet fines.
